I told you guys how I gave Audible a try for the first time last month.  Well, we've had The Total Money Makeover sitting on our bookshelf for over a year now, so I decided to go ahead and just listen to it.  I listen to Davey Ramsey's podcast sometimes and actually really enjoy it.  His advice is always spot on and he's pretty funny as well.  Between a previous book of his I read, Financial Peace, going through Financial Peace University, and listening to his podcasts on and off for a few years, there wasn't a lot that I hadn't heard him say before.  However, it's always motivating to listen to him as we work to reach our financial goals.  Michael is listening to this book now as well.

My brother Billy got me Nicholas Sparks' new book Two By Two for Christmas.  I have read all of his books and was excited to finally get started on his latest.  It usually doesn't take me long to get sucked in to the point where I can barely put his books down.  For this book though, I was almost a third of the way through before I started feeling like that.  It's a fairly long book (almost 500 pages), and there were a few times where I felt like the storyline was moving along rather slowly.  That being said, I still really liked it overall and am a bit sad to be finished with it.  Also, the last several chapters are not what I predicted them to be largely about as I was reading the first part of the book!

I helped Clara make a fun craft for Valentine's Day.  We went through our crayons and pulled out the broken ones and then used a crayon sharpener to turn them into shavings.  Clara then designed them on some wax paper.  We put another piece of wax paper on top.  Then I placed a plain piece of paper on top of it all and quickly ran the iron over it a few times.  After letting them cool we cut out hearts and put them up in her window as sun catchers.  Next time I'll advise Clara to use less crayon shavings so the crayon layer will be thinner and allow more light through.  Fun way to use up broken crayons!
